     32 package org.jf.dexlib2.dexbacked.value;
     33 
     34 import org.jf.dexlib2.base.value.BaseAnnotationEncodedValue;
     35 import org.jf.dexlib2.dexbacked.DexBackedAnnotationElement;
     36 import org.jf.dexlib2.dexbacked.DexBackedDexFile;
     37 import org.jf.dexlib2.dexbacked.DexReader;
     38 import org.jf.dexlib2.dexbacked.util.VariableSizeSet;
     39 import org.jf.dexlib2.iface.value.AnnotationEncodedValue;
     40 
     41 import javax.annotation.Nonnull;
     42 import java.util.Set;
     43 
     44 public class DexBackedAnnotationEncodedValue extends BaseAnnotationEncodedValue implements AnnotationEncodedValue {
     45     @Nonnull public final DexBackedDexFile dexFile;
     46     @Nonnull public final String type;
     47     private final int elementCount;
     48     private final int elementsOffset;
     49 
     50     public DexBackedAnnotationEncodedValue(@Nonnull DexReader reader) {
     51         this.dexFile = reader.dexBuf;
     52         this.type = dexFile.getType(reader.readSmallUleb128());
     53         this.elementCount = reader.readSmallUleb128();
     54         this.elementsOffset = reader.getOffset();
     55         skipElements(reader, elementCount);
     56     }
     57 
     58     public static void skipFrom(@Nonnull DexReader reader) {
     59         reader.skipUleb128(); // type
     60         int elementCount = reader.readSmallUleb128();
     61         skipElements(reader, elementCount);
     62     }
     63 
     64     private static void skipElements(@Nonnull DexReader reader, int elementCount) {
     65         for (int i=0; i<elementCount; i++) {
     66             reader.skipUleb128();
     67             DexBackedEncodedValue.skipFrom(reader);
     68         }
     69     }
     70 
     71     @Nonnull @Override public String getType() { return type; }
     72 
     73     @Nonnull
     74     @Override
     75     public Set<? extends DexBackedAnnotationElement> getElements() {
     76         return new VariableSizeSet<DexBackedAnnotationElement>(dexFile, elementsOffset, elementCount) {
     77             @Nonnull
     78             @Override
     79             protected DexBackedAnnotationElement readNextItem(@Nonnull DexReader dexReader, int index) {
     80                 return new DexBackedAnnotationElement(dexReader);
     81             }
     82         };
     83     }
     84 }
